Oh wow, so much hate. Chill out guys.
Oh boy kobefans, what a mess, but you do have options.
The paper that you signed, as long as you get to keep a copy of it with yours and your landlord's signature, it should suffice (I am assuming here that it's some sort of agreement between you and the landlord about the terms and conditions of your rental.) You may get more information by contacting these folks: http://www.tenants.bc.ca/
I'm a little bit confused about your case, since you seem like the straight and narrow type while your landlord is obviously on the WAY shady side, why would you choose to live there? Either way, yes, you can report these things to the police. Unfortunately, your landlord will probably kick you out as a result (if not worse).
Actually, if you want, you can probably walk into the Chanel/Louis Vuitton store downtown, provide your landlord's information (address, etc.), tell them that he's selling a bunch of fake Chanels/LVs and they will take care of it for you. They have as much interest in keeping guys (like your landlord) shut down as you do, if not more. This way, its a little more subtle than reporting them to the police, which will require YOUR NAME as the complainant.
^now, I'm not sure how effective it will be to report to the respective stores, but at the purse forum, several of the ladies managed to get shops/businesses shut down once they reported it to the store. I will gladly make a thread specific to your situation if you want, so you know that the ladies did that worked for them.
That's all I have, hope that helps!

FYI, you don't report to the police about tax related issues.. if you talk to any tax lawyer / accountant, they will gladly give you the CRA's snitch line.
However for the fake goods parts.. it is better that you talk to the original manufacturers.. They are the ones that initiate most of the investigation and give people a reward. keep a list of info, eg license plates dates etc etc. Even better a webcam.
